OpenMetal has unveiled its latest GPU infrastructure, engineered for developers and enterprises looking to scale their artificial intelligence (AI), machine learning (ML), and high-performance computing (HPC) workloads.
Purpose-Built for AI Innovators
In response to the growing limitations of public cloud GPU access—including excessive pricing, throttled speeds, and limited control—OpenMetal has released its Private GPU Servers and GPU Clusters. These new offerings are tailored for innovators building large language models, deploying inference clusters, or experimenting with generative AI at scale.
With fully dedicated access to NVIDIA’s top-tier A100 and H100 GPUs, users gain complete root-level control over bare-metal servers. This setup ensures optimal performance, maximum privacy, and seamless integration with OpenStack environments.
Key Features of OpenMetal’s GPU Infrastructure
- Advanced NVIDIA GPUs: Choose from A100, H100, and other models to suit various performance demands and budgets.
- True Bare Metal Access: No virtualization layers—just raw power and control.
- Transparent Pricing: Monthly billing with no hidden charges or unpredictable egress costs.
Flexible Solutions Across Industries
OpenMetal’s infrastructure is not just for tech startups. Enterprises in healthcare, finance, and research are also leveraging its GPU clusters for mission-critical operations where data control and compliance are paramount.
Users can fully customize server clusters, selecting GPU quantities, CPU/GPU matches, memory, and storage configurations. The infrastructure is API-first, enabling smooth integration with DevOps pipelines and MLOps platforms like TensorFlow, PyTorch, and Hugging Face.
Global Availability
The new GPU Servers and Clusters are currently accessible in both U.S. East and West coast regions. OpenMetal has plans to expand its reach to Europe and Asia by the end of the year, further empowering AI development with regional flexibility.
